In the Lower Mainland–Southwest, it’s common to see the same electrical job priced 30–50% apart across British Columbia because contractors face different site conditions, inspection timelines, and material sourcing costs. The dominant cost driver in Mount Currie is the housing stock: older homes tend to require more diagnostics, more labour time, and more safety work before any “nice to have” upgrades can happen. For example, homes built before 1950 can have legacy wiring that insurance carriers increasingly challenge, while many homes from the 1960s to 1970s have older panels (often 60A or 100A) that struggle with today’s combined loads—EV charging, heat pumps or electric furnace assistance, and high-wattage appliances like induction stoves. In that same era, aluminum branch wiring is also more likely, and remediation typically means licensed work using approved connectors (CO/ALR) or full replacement.
EV adoption is also accelerating demand for Level 2 charger permits, and that can push projects into panel or service upgrade territory to maintain capacity and fault-current compliance. A 40A charger circuit may fit a particular panel margin, but a 50A circuit can tip the load calculation enough that a panel upgrade becomes the safer option—moving pricing toward the $1,800–$4,500 panel/service band. Similarly, if you’re removing knob-and-tube or remediating aluminum, the project can land in the $8,000–$20,000 wiring band because of wall openings, tracing work, and replacement of affected runs.
Two local examples where cost rises: (1) when the service/mast and meter area needs coordination with BC Hydro, timelines can expand and crews may stage materials differently; (2) when exterior charging locations require weatherproof routing and careful penetrations in cool, damp months. Cost can drop when the existing panel has spare breakers and the wiring path is short and accessible—fewer openings, fewer surprises, and less labour time.

In British Columbia, ALL electrical work beyond changing a light bulb must be done by a licensed electrician. That includes panel upgrades, rewiring, adding new circuits, and installing or altering equipment that connects to the electrical system—such as Level 2 EV chargers, hot tub circuits, HVAC circuits, and service upgrades. In practice, most “permit-required” work includes any change to the service equipment, any new branch circuit with a new breaker, and any replacement of wiring methods that affects safety and code compliance. Minor swaps like replacing a fixture or a receptacle cover may be limited to what’s allowed for homeowners, but once wiring connections are involved, assume a permit and inspection are required.
All permitted work must pass inspection by the provincial electrical safety authority: in BC this is overseen through the Technical Safety BC framework. DIY electrical is heavily restricted; homeowner exceptions are narrow and still typically require permits and inspection depending on what is being altered.
To verify a contractor for a Mount Currie project, start with the electrician/contractor’s licence on the province’s online registry (licence status and whether the correct category is listed). Next, request a certificate of insurance that shows liability coverage (ask for the current COI) and confirm WSBC/WCB coverage—many reputable electrical contractors will provide proof up front. Before work begins, ask for a clear permit/inspection plan and whether they’ll include permit pulling, especially for service changes that may require utility coordination.
Homeowners in Mount Currie should treat electrical red flags as safety-and-insurability issues, not just inconveniences. Start with breakers that trip regularly—this often points to an overloaded panel, failing connections, or undersized circuits. If that happens alongside added loads (a new EV charger, a heat pump, or electric furnace usage), it’s usually a planned upgrade, not a “replace the breaker” fix.
Knob-and-tube wiring is another major concern. The key issue isn’t only the age; deteriorated insulation and contact conditions can increase risk over time, and many insurers won’t cover homes with unresolved knob-and-tube. In many situations, whole-home replacement or targeted removal and rewiring is the safer long-term route.
Then look at your service size. Homes with 60A or 100A service can feel fine until modern loads run together—especially when a Level 2 EV charger shares a broader electrical footprint. The standard solution is a panel/service upgrade toward 200A capacity. For example, moving from an undersized service toward the $1,800–$4,500 panel/service band can be worth it compared with repeatedly adding new circuits that keep tripping or forcing last-minute charger limitations.
Aluminum wiring (more common in pre-1976 construction) isn’t always “immediate danger” if it has been properly maintained, but it does require licensed remediation and approved connectors or replacement sections to prevent heat and loose-connection problems. Finally, insufficient outlets and missing AFCI/GFCI where required can trigger sale delays and safety concerns; those issues are usually code-compliance upgrades rather than emergency repairs.
In BC’s cool, damp seasons, moisture-related failures at outdoor and exterior penetrations also crop up more often, so prioritize inspections if you notice corrosion, loose weatherproofing, or repeated nuisance faults.

Choosing the right contractor is especially important in Mount Currie because many projects involve older wiring methods, panel/service capacity checks, and permit coordination. First, verify British Columbia licensing: ask for the contractor’s licence number and confirm it through the provincial licence registry. Next, request a certificate of insurance (liability coverage) and verify workers’ compensation coverage under the applicable BC system—many established electrical contractors will provide proof of coverage without delay.
Get 2–3 written, itemised quotes. Ideally, your quote breaks out labour and materials separately and lists what’s included for permits, inspections, and disposal. Don’t accept “lump sum only” unless the scope is extremely clear; for older homes, wording like “as required” can hide cost swings. Ask whether the permit is pulled by the electrician, whether inspection fees are included, and whether removal of old panel components or wiring is included (or billed separately). If BC Hydro coordination is needed for a service or mast upgrade, confirm who handles scheduling and whether the price includes the waiting period.
Warranty matters. Look for a workmanship warranty (often 1 year minimum, sometimes longer) and clarify manufacturer warranties on equipment like breakers and EV charger components, including whether they are transferable. Payment schedules should be conservative—never pay more than 10–15% upfront; hold back a portion until the job is complete and inspected. Finally, request a start date and completion estimate in writing, so you understand whether you’re waiting for materials or inspection scheduling.
Red flags I commonly see in Mount Currie electrical quotes include: (1) no mention of permits/inspections, (2) “we’ll do it without a load calculation” for a service change, (3) vague scope like “rewire as needed” without identifying the circuits, (4) refusing to provide insurance/licence details, and (5) asking for a large upfront payment with no inspection milestones or warranty terms.
If you’re living in Mount Currie and your breakers trip when you run multiple appliances, heat sources, or charging equipment, that’s a common sign of panel overload or unsafe circuit loading. Other clues include breakers that feel warm, discoloured panel interiors, frequent nuisance trips, buzzing sounds from the panel, and lights that noticeably dim when a high-load device starts. Overload risk is higher in homes where electric heating runs often and where additional loads are added over time—like Level 2 EV chargers (40–50A) plus modern kitchen appliances. A licensed electrician can confirm this with a load calculation and inspection. If the calculation shows insufficient service capacity, upgrading toward the $1,800–$4,500 panel/service band is often the safest way to restore normal operation instead of constantly “adding circuits around the problem.”

Rewiring timelines in Mount Currie depend heavily on whether you’re doing targeted circuit replacement or a whole-home rewire, plus access to walls and ceilings. A full or near full rewire can take longer because it usually involves opening finishes, replacing conductors, installing modern protection devices, and then closing everything up before inspection. In many cases, the schedule also depends on inspection booking through Technical Safety BC processes after permit approval. If older wiring methods like knob-and-tube are present, expect extra time for tracing and safe removal, and possibly for discovery of additional affected runs. For budgeting, rewiring projects commonly fall in the $8,000–$20,000 band, but time is a key part of that cost—labour hours grow when concealed runs are harder to access. Ask your contractor for a phased plan (rough-in, test, inspection, trim-out) in writing.
Breakers that keep tripping in a British Columbia home usually come from one of three categories: circuit overload, a fault (like a damaged connection or appliance issue), or wiring/protection mismatch. In older Mount Currie homes, the cause can be complicated by legacy wiring methods, aluminum remediation needs, or panels that don’t match modern load patterns. Heat sources running together with kitchen loads and EV charging are a frequent trigger—especially when there’s no room for additional capacity. Start by identifying which breaker trips and what load was running right before it happens; then stop repeatedly resetting it—persistent tripping can indicate a developing fault. A licensed electrician should inspect connections, test circuits, and confirm correct breaker sizing. If the inspection shows insufficient service capacity, a panel upgrade toward the $1,800–$4,500 band may be justified to stop nuisance trips at their root.
When comparing electrical quotes in Mount Currie, don’t compare totals first—compare scope. Ask for itemised breakdowns: labour hours, material lists, allowance items, and permit/inspection fees. Confirm whether BC Hydro coordination is included for any service or mast work, and whether disposal of old equipment or wiring debris is included. Quotes also vary because older homes often require different levels of diagnostic work (for example, knob-and-tube removal and replacement vs. targeted fixes). Make sure all quotes are using the same assumptions about circuit amperage for EV chargers (40A vs. 50A) and whether a load calculation will be performed for service upgrades. If one quote lands in the $8,000–$20,000 wiring range while another is lower, it should clearly explain what wiring methods are being replaced. Lastly, verify the electrician’s BC licence and insurance before accepting anything.
Panel upgrades in Mount Currie typically take a few hours of direct work time on-site, but the full timeline can be longer once you include permit pulling, inspection scheduling, and—when needed—BC Hydro coordination. The on-site portion involves shutting down safely, removing and installing the new panel equipment, transferring conductors, labelling circuits, and performing required testing before inspection. If your current wiring layout is clean and access is straightforward, the job can move quickly. If older wiring methods or workmanship issues are discovered during the upgrade (common in pre-1980 homes), electricians may need extra time for remediation, which can extend the schedule and cost. Most panel/service upgrades budget toward the $1,800–$4,500 band, but the best way to predict duration is to request a written timeline that includes permit and inspection steps.
